Default KIOSKS

Getting ready to install Kiosks at High Bridge Disc Golf Course. David Smith and I have designed and are nearly done with the construction. These are heavy duty, durable and made of 4 x 6 x 10's. They have a posting area of 42" x 42" and are 2 sided. One side will be covered and the other open. These will be installed at holes #11 and #1. Open to ideas about placement as well.

Here are some topics that I'm including on the Kiosks. Tell me what you would like to see on them and this may be included in the future.

Course Sign
Upcoming Divisional Tournaments
Course Map
Basic Rules
Exceptional Scores and Recent Aces
SDGA Weekly Tournaments
Needs
Disc Golf Etiquette
Sponsorship (Business recognition for Hole Sponsorship)
Thank you to the Latah Creek Community (grant for the purchase of materials)
Information Resources
Work Parties
Elections
Thank You's (for work done etc.)
I'm considering having an area on the back-side for local advertising, since these flyers are stuck to the Tee Signs all the time - we might as well have a 'designated', limited area for them.

Have I left anything out that you feel would be essential? Let me know.

Looks like a very busy kiosk...

'Important':
Course Sign/Map
Basic Rules/Disc Golf Etiquette
Calendar
Thank you to the Latah Creek Community (grant for the purchase of materials)
Club/Information Resources

Personally, it seems like these things would need to be covered.



The other stuff could easily be posted by individuals or organizers, on the reverse side of the kiosk.
This idea might put more focus on the 'important' stuff.

Other side:
Tourneys, Events, and Work Parties can be posted on the Calendar. (covered side)
Hole sponsors are recognized at the tee signs.
Needs seem like a club focus rather than a public one... maybe this is a great resource though?
Exceptional scores and Aces (great idea) would need player access.
Thank you's would probably require access as well... not sure
Player comment sheet 'could' be useful.
